Danand Posted October 31, 2019 Share Posted October 31, 2019 To sum up The Ravens have won 3 while the Patriots have won 10 4 of those Patriots victories came in the pre-Flacco era against Testavarde, Tony Banks and Kyle Boller In the 9 games in the Flacco era, only 2 games have been played at M&T Bank Stadium with a win for both teams, a 31-30 Ravens win and a 44-7 dismantling of the Ravens with a Superp Owl hangover. In the Flacco era, the Ravens have (besides the dismantling in 2013) played the Patriots tough and only lost one score games. 4 out of 5 losses in that span was with a field goal or less. The argument about playing the Patriots tough is supported by 2 of the 3 Ravens wins coming in the playoffs with 2 close playoffs losses - one which came down to Lee Evans drop/Cundiff miss - it still hurts, and another that took some creative lining up/trick plays from the Patriots - Harbaugh is still mad about it.
